deeptho / neumodvb

neumoDVB DVB-S2/DVB-T/DVB-C settop box and DX program for Linux
Other
17 stars 8 forks source link

NeumoDVB

NeumoDVB is a DVB Settop box and dx-program for linux. Its supports advanced muti-tuner cards based on the stid135 chip, such as TBS-6909x and TBS-6903x and simpler cards based on stv091x like tbs5927, on tas2101 like tbs5990 and on si2183 like tbs6504 and tbs5580 Some of the features include

To install and use neumoDVB, please read the instructions below. Many users don't bother and then start wasting other people's time by asking questions answered in the documentation. Needless to say, this demotivates developers.

neumoDVB cna be installed in two different ways

Changes

Compilation/Installation from github

Installation from debian and rpm packages

Troubleshooting

Reporting bugs

Getting Started with neumoDVB

Start the program from the Linux command line as follows if you wish to run it from the build directory:

~/neumodvb/gui/neumodvb.py

If instead you have installed it, then run it as /usr/bin/neumodvb. If all goes well a mostly empty, dark window will appear and no errors should appear on the console. Some debug messages may appear in /tmp/neumo.log.

Now follow the first steps to configure neumoDVB

The next step is to define some valid `muxes', i.e., to define tuning information. This can be done in multiple ways.

The last step is to check the services list. If all went well, services will appear there. You can tune one of them by selecting Control - Tune and then view the service by Control - Live Screen. The L key hides the service list which is also shown on this screen. Pressing it a second time will bring back the GUI. Pressing Ctrl-F will enter full screen mode

Other Documentation

Changing options

Frontend configuration

LNB configuration

Scanning muxes

Scanning satellite bands

Automating scanning

Managing channels

Status list

Viewing and recording TV

Streaming services and muxes

Spectrum analysis

Positioner control

Dish list

Signal history

Filtering lists

Using external programs with neumoDVB

GUI Design in neumoDVB